3 Types of Cracks to Worry About in Your Home’s Foundation
Your home’s foundation is quite literally what everything else rests on. While some cracks are harmless, others are a sign of serious structural issues.
Here are the three types of foundation cracks you should never ignore:
1. Horizontal Cracks – A Red Flag for Structural Movement
Horizontal cracks typically form in concrete block or poured foundations and are often caused by pressure from the soil outside the foundation wall. In Middle Tennessee, where clay soil expands and contracts, this type of movement is not uncommon.
🚨 Why it matters:
Horizontal cracks may indicate that your foundation wall is bowing or shifting. This is a serious structural issue that can worsen over time.
2. Stair-Step Cracks – A Sign of Settling or Shifting
Stair-step cracks usually appear in brick or block foundations and follow the mortar lines in a step-like pattern. These often occur when part of your foundation settles more than the rest, leading to uneven stress on the structure.
🚨 Why it matters:
They can be a symptom of foundation settlement or water damage. If you see widening cracks or doors and windows sticking, it’s time to take action.
3. Wide Vertical Cracks – More Than Just Shrinkage
While narrow vertical cracks are common and often caused by concrete shrinkage, wide vertical cracks (especially over 1/8 inch) are cause for concern. These can be a sign of foundation movement due to soil changes, water intrusion, or poor construction.
🚨 Why it matters:
If left unchecked, these cracks can lead to water leakage, pest entry, and reduced structural integrity.
